* Stars are formed from massive clouds of gas and dust. The amount of material that collapses to form a star determines its initial size.
* Stars have different masses. Stars with more mass are larger and hotter than stars with less mass.
* Stars evolve over time. As stars age, they change in size. Some stars, like our Sun, will eventually become red giants, which are much larger than they are now. Others, like massive stars, will explode as supernovas, leaving behind dense remnants called neutron stars or black holes.
